Subject: 95 4x4 5.2ltr questions
IP: Logged

Message:
I have 3 questions about my truck.

1. The truck seems to run good all around except when i get on a hill. as i start to climb the hillthe engine begins to cut out or miss causing a lack of power. if i let off the gas alittle i can still make it up the hill but there is a lack of power. i just changed the cap and rotor but this did not fix the problem. what could be causing this?

2. Coming to stops i have noticed a little "clunk" in the front end some where. there is a light tapping or clicking going down the road sometimes also. when i engage 4x4 and do any turning there is a hellish knocking/clunking/metal sound in the front end. axles look to be in good condition and all ball joints seem ok and tight. something i can test?

3. the AC was working very good last season, this season it was working good also but hasn't been as cold. i bought a recharge 134a kit but i am a bit nervous as to how to fill the system. the can says to plug into the low pressure service port, which i am not sure of. In the engine bay there is a sticker that says it is a high pressure system and should only be charged professionally.
any ideas?

thanks very much in advance

well i have a 93 5.2l 4x4 and have experienced the issues you have sort of:
1) my guess would be the fuel pump or a possible fuel line leak. I found when trying to climb hills, i'd loose power too. since then, i've run a couple of cans of Seafoam through the system, poured it in the PCV valve line, and in the gas tank and in through the carbs (took air cleaner out). the truck smoked like crazy, but it seemed to work. Gave the system a good clean for sure. I can hear my fuel pump whining, so i imagine it's on the way out, but until then, i was happy with the Seafoam fix. you can get it at most good parts stores.

2) my clunking was from a bad universal joint

3) can't help you there.
